Labor Dept Reviews Fatal Job Injury Census: Keeping Workers Safe?
Published Date: 9/16/2025
Notice
Summary
The Department of Labor is asking for approval to keep collecting info about workplace deaths through the Census of Fatal Occupational Injuries. This helps keep workers safe by tracking how and where fatal accidents happen.
